CourseDetails
โข Fundamentals of Heat Transfer: An introductory unit covering the basics of heat transfer, including conduction, convection, and radiation. This unit will establish the foundation for understanding more advanced heat transfer concepts.
โข Advanced Heat Transfer Techniques: This unit delves into advanced heat transfer methods, including phase change processes, heat exchangers, and regenerators.
โข Thermodynamics and Heat Transfer: This unit explores the relationship between thermodynamics and heat transfer, including the first and second laws of thermodynamics, entropy, and exergy analysis.
โข Heat Transfer in Industrial Applications: This unit examines the application of heat transfer principles in various industries, including power generation, chemical processing, and HVAC systems.
โข Computational Heat Transfer: This unit introduces computational methods for modeling and simulating heat transfer processes, including finite difference, finite element, and boundary element methods.
โข Heat Transfer Materials and Equipment: This unit explores the materials and equipment used in heat transfer applications, including conductive and radiative materials, heat exchangers, and insulation materials.
โข Experimental Methods in Heat Transfer: This unit covers experimental techniques for measuring heat transfer coefficients and other relevant parameters, including transient and steady-state methods, and the use of thermal probes and sensors.
โข Emerging Technologies in Heat Transfer: This unit examines recent advances in heat transfer technology, including nanofluids, micro- and macro-scale heat transfer, and additive manufacturing.
โข Sustainable Heat Transfer Systems: This unit explores the design and implementation of sustainable heat transfer systems, including energy efficiency, renewable energy sources, and life-cycle analysis.
